Exige and Elise Vehicles Recalled by Lotus Over Fire and Crash Threats

Posted on February 27, 2013

Exige and Elise vehicles of the 2007 through 2008 model years have been recalled by Lotus because of an issue that could lead to either a crash or a fire.  451 vehicles in total are thought to be affected by the recall, which was initiated upon discovery that the detachment of the oil cooler line from the fitting is a possibility.  The could lead the tire to be sprayed with oil, a condition which might cause the vehicle to crash.  Or, the oil could filter into the engine compartment and catch fire.  Either condition would obviously be dangerous.  The recall is set to start at the beginning of next week, at which point owners will hear from Lotus.  The affected components will be replaced by dealers at no cost to the consumer.
